Interfacial nano-engineering of electrodes for perovskite solar cells
Purpose:
This project aims to explore new strategies of functional electrode design and interfacial engineering for efficient and stable perovskite solar cell application. The key concept is to modify the electron transport and perovskite layers through structural design, interfacial engineering and contact passivation, for use in high-performance solar-to-electricity conversion systems with improved light harvesting and charge collection. Expected project outcomes will place Australia at the forefront of practical low-cost and large-scale solar energy conversion technologies.
